The Importance of Animal Disinfectants in Veterinary Medicine
In modern veterinary medicine, maintaining a clean and safe environment is crucial to ensuring the health and well-being of animals. One of the most effective strategies for achieving this is the use of animal disinfectants. These specialized cleaning agents are designed to reduce or eliminate harmful pathogens that can cause diseases in animals, thereby playing a significant role in preventing outbreaks and promoting overall animal welfare.
Understanding Animal Disinfectants
Animal disinfectants are formulated to target a broad spectrum of microorganisms, including bacteria, viruses, fungi, and parasites. These disinfectants come in various forms, including sprays, wipes, and solutions, and are often used in settings such as veterinary clinics, animal shelters, farms, and laboratories. The effectiveness of a disinfectant is generally evaluated based on its ability to kill or inactivate pathogens rapidly while being safe for animal use.
The Importance of Disinfection in Veterinary Settings
1. Prevention of Disease Transmission In veterinary clinics and animal shelters, numerous animals come into contact with shared spaces and surfaces. This close interaction can facilitate the transmission of infectious diseases. Regular disinfection of surfaces such as kennels, examination tables, and surgical instruments helps minimize the risk of spreading illnesses from one animal to another.
2. Control of Outbreaks When a contagious disease is suspected or detected in a facility, effective use of disinfectants can help control the outbreak. Thorough cleaning and disinfection protocols must be established and implemented rapidly to prevent further cases. For instance, after an outbreak of Canine Parvovirus or Feline Leukemia, comprehensive disinfection is critical to safeguard the health of remaining animals.
3. Promoting Animal Health and Welfare A clean environment contributes to the overall health of animals. Disinfectants help in eliminating harmful pathogens that can lead to infections, thus promoting the well-being of both domestic and farm animals. By ensuring that animals are housed in hygienic conditions, veterinarians and caregivers can significantly improve their quality of life.
4. Reducing Veterinary Costs Preventative measures, including regular disinfection, can lead to significant cost savings in veterinary care. Treating infectious diseases can be expensive and time-consuming, with additional costs involving hospitalization, medications, and lost productivity. By reducing the incidence of disease through effective disinfection practices, veterinary clinics can save money while enhancing their service quality.
Selecting the Right Disinfectant
When choosing an animal disinfectant, several factors must be considered
- Effectiveness Not all disinfectants are created equal; selecting a product that has been tested and proven effective against specific pathogens is essential. The label should provide information about the spectrum of activity and contact time required to achieve disinfection.
- Safety The safety of animals and humans is paramount when selecting disinfectants. Non-toxic, biodegradable options should be prioritized, especially in environments where animals may be sensitive to chemicals. It's vital to choose products that do not leave harmful residues on surfaces that animals frequently come into contact with.
- Ease of Use Disinfectants should be user-friendly, requiring minimal training to apply effectively. They should also have a long shelf-life and be compatible with various materials commonly found in veterinary settings.
